REGULATION OF ELECTRICAL INSTALLATIONS BY LICENSING BOARD
(Cite as: 26 V.S.A. § 894)
-
§ 894. Energizing installations
(a) A new electrical installation in or on a complex structure or an electrical installation
used for the testing or construction of a complex structure shall not be connected
or caused to be connected, to a source of electrical energy unless prior to such connection,
either a temporary or a permanent energizing permit is issued for that installation
by the Commissioner or an electrical inspector.
(b) This section shall not be construed to limit or interfere with a contractor’s right
to receive payment for electrical work for which a certificate of completion has been
granted. (Added 1969, No. 284 (Adj. Sess.), § 3; amended 1987, No. 274 (Adj. Sess.), § 6.)
